Ignoring for a moment HOW you may have lost your pre-existing camera files, for simplicity and so we can all see what is going on, you need to look at your One's storage with Windows Explorer.
Connect the TT to the PC, and if Home starts up...shut it down.
Then open Windows Explorer and you should find the One as a new disk drive (complete with a drive letter, just like your PC's hard drive).

Browse the One's storage and you should see a folder named after whatever map you own (Western Europe, UK and Ireland etc.)
If you open that folder, you may or may not find a load of files with names beginning "Safety_Cam _UK_TomTom..."

If you have them, you can easily get your (out of date) camera database up and running again.
If not, you will be able to re-install the files IF you have a good backup.

If you don't have a good backup, you need to make one as a matter of urgency, in case you lose any more vital files. Instructions on making backups are in the FAQs in the TomTom section of this forum... do not use "Home" to do this.

As you may know, there is a demo version of TomTom's own speed camera database supplied pre-installed on most new machines, and you usually have ONE free update. After that you are expected to buy a subscription to keep it updated, so if you don't have a backup of the files you won't be able to get them from TomTom without paying.

As indicated by others, most people here consider the TomTom offering to be pretty poor anyway and would rather pay for the one from this site.
